Here is a brief overview of each role and why it is relevant in today's industry: 1. **Brand Partnership Director**: As a key decision-maker, a Brand Partnership Director oversees the development and execution of brand partnership strategies. In an era of increased collaboration, their role is indispensable in creating successful and lucrative partnerships. 2. **Communications Strategist**: A Communications Strategist designs and implements effective communication plans that align with a brand's objectives. Their expertise is essential in managing and enhancing a company's reputation and relationships with its stakeholders. 3. **Digital Brand Partnership Manager**: In the digital age, a Digital Brand Partnership Manager facilitates and manages partnerships between brands and digital platforms. Their role is instrumental in leveraging digital channels for maximum brand exposure and engagement. 4. **Content & Partnership Development Manager**: This role combines content development and brand partnership skills to create compelling narratives and experiences that resonate with target audiences. In an increasingly content-driven world, their expertise is highly sought after. 5. **Brand Partnership Analyst**: A Brand Partnership Analyst evaluates the performance of brand partnerships and communications strategies, using data-driven insights to optimize campaigns and achieve better results. Their role is vital in ensuring the continuous improvement and success of brand partnership initiatives.
